A PATTERN 1897 EDWARD VII INFANTRY OFFICER'S SWORD BY MOLE, issue date 1903, with 32 1/2 in. blade, ricasso marked 'MOLE / BIRMm.' with '8'03' and inspection marks over, steel guard with Edward VII Royal Cypher, wire-bound fish-skin grip, together with its brown leather scabbard, stained with rust patches, scabbard heavily worn with significant losses to the leather
